Transaction 9689887e7268be6a94f8882a6099a9456b5ad8375b2aaa835d9f1528fd2439af
1 Input
1 Output
-
9689887e7268be6a94f8882a6099a9456b5ad8375b2aaa835d9f1528fd2439af:0
- value
- 544852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c57005af4741055e0a093979067154cb69d0409c OP_EQUAL
- address
- 3KgyEmpqUh4ciAZfKrJK5Bvc59T1hWxQTz